SUMMARY
Every SSID is duplicated for every additional wifi adapter you plug in (it is
hard to show this as SSIDs are semi unique and can be use to geolocate people
(wigle.net)

For the status bar pop out widget, it at least tries to de-duplicate by showing
the interfaces (wlan0/wlan1). This doesn’t happen for the view in System
Settings.

Both of these approaches aren’t very good, I think something like Windows
should be done where a drop down at the top becomes available to the SSIDs for
each adapter:
